For Nested, I transformed the phrase “sin miedo al éxito”  (without fear of succeeding) into a tightly fitted typographic composition contained within a 7″ × 7″ square. The goal was to explore how letterforms can interlock, overlap, and respond to negative space while still preserving clarity and rhythm. I developed the layout in Adobe Illustrator, refining the spacing and shapes until the phrase felt cohesive and structurally unified. Once finalized, the vector artwork was converted into a Shaper file and extruded for 3D printing, turning the flat composition into a physical object. This project strengthened my understanding of spatial typography, precision vector work, and preparing type-based designs for fabrication.
